When cooking eggs it may happen sometimes that the egg shell becomes cracked. To avoid this, you can use a little scientific trick. In the rounded bottom of the egg resides an air pocket which is also the one that expands during heating and makes the egg shell break. You need therefore to find a way to let the air escape out of the egg. Simply take a needle or with a very sharp edge point of the knife, make a tiny hole in the bottom of the egg. Then cook it as usual. Note though that this not always works!
